Some devices use PCA963x controllers to drive RGB LEDs, where
multiple PWM channels correspond to a single logical LED. Add
support for grouping such channels into a multicolor LED device,
using the LED multicolor class framework.
The DT bindings are extended to describe these groupings via a
multi-led@N node with sub-nodes representing individual color
channels. This follows conventions used by other multicolor LED
drivers, while maintaining full backward compatibility with
existing single-color LED definitions.
The PCA963x driver is updated accordingly to detect these grouped
definitions and register multicolor LEDs.
Finally, the Monaco Arduino Monza device tree is updated to expose
the onboard MCU-controlled LEDs (compatible with PCA9635). The MCU
manages four RGB LEDs mapped to channels 0–11, which are described
using the new multicolor bindings.

The pca9635 supports 16 LED channels, unlike the pca9634 which only
supports 8. The allOf conditional grouped both chips under a single
else branch capping reg at a maximum of 7.
Give pca9634 its own if/then block and set maximum: 15 unconditionally
in the top-level led@ node, making it the default for pca9635 and any
future compatible. Also tighten the node name regex from [0-9a-f]+ to
[0-9a-f] to match the single-digit hardware limit.

Add support for grouping individual PCA963x channels into a multicolor
LED by introducing a multi-led@N node pattern. This follows the
convention established by other multicolor LED drivers such as
kinetic,ktd202x.
This is necessary to support and model hardware setups where multiple
PWM channels drive a single physical RGB LED.

Allow grouping of individual PCA963x PWM channels into a single
multicolor LED device by adding support for the LED multicolor class.
A child node with sub-children is treated as a multicolor group,
others are treated as single leds, keeping full backwards compatibility.

[Severity: High]
This is a pre-existing issue, but are global chip registers modified without
acquiring the chip mutex here?
drivers/leds/leds-pca963x.c:pca963x_blink() {
...
i2c_smbus_write_byte_data(client, chipdef->grppwm, led->gdc);
i2c_smbus_write_byte_data(client, chipdef->grpfreq, led->gfrq);
if (!(mode2 & PCA963X_MODE2_DMBLNK))
i2c_smbus_write_byte_data(client, PCA963X_MODE2,
mode2 | PCA963X_MODE2_DMBLNK);
mutex_lock(&led->chip->mutex);
...
}
If user-space initiates hardware blinking for two different LEDs concurrently,
could their writes to these global frequency and duty cycle registers
interleave and corrupt the hardware blink state for the entire chip?

[Severity: High]
This is a pre-existing issue, but does assigning the result of
i2c_smbus_read_byte_data() directly to a u8 silently truncate negative error
codes?
If the read fails and returns -EIO, this would truncate the negative error
code into a garbage unsigned 8-bit integer, and we then write it back to the
chip in pca963x_brightness():
drivers/leds/leds-pca963x.c:pca963x_brightness() {
...
ledout = i2c_smbus_read_byte_data(client, ledout_addr);
...
val = (ledout & ~mask) | (PCA963X_LED_ON << shift);
ret = i2c_smbus_write_byte_data(client, ledout_addr, val);
...
}
The same pattern appears in pca963x_blink() with the mode2 variable. Could
this cause hardware register corruption during a transient I2C failure?
